2020 LKR to LSL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2020

During 2020, the LKR to LSL ex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on May 7, valuing the pair at 0.1000.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 23, dropping to 0.0766.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0234 LSL.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0791 to the December average rate of 0.0796, the exchange rate registered a net change of 0.56%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2020 high of 0.1000 was up 14.60% compared to the 2019 peak of 0.0873,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.0815 0.0772 0.0791
February 0.0847 0.0813 0.0825
March 0.0950 0.0840 0.0900
April 0.0992 0.0941 0.0968
May 0.1000 0.0933 0.0969
June 0.0939 0.0897 0.0922
July 0.0922 0.0886 0.0902
August 0.0959 0.0896 0.0930
September 0.0925 0.0872 0.0905
October 0.0906 0.0877 0.0893
November 0.0883 0.0821 0.0841
December 0.0824 0.0766 0.0796
